Biography

Leo Yang’s academic path began at the University of British Columbia, where he earned a Bachelor of Arts in Psychology in 2018. This background provided him with a deep understanding of human behavior and communication, skills that would later become essential in his legal career. He then moved to Arizona to attend the Sandra Day O’Connor College of Law at Arizona State University. During his time in law school, he focused on mastering the complexities of the legal system and developing a sharp analytical mindset, ultimately earning his Juris Doctor in 2024.

Throughout his legal training and early career, Leo has built extensive litigation experience, including a track record of successfully litigating various motions in court. His versatile background allows him to handle an incredibly broad range of cases, from personal injury matters like car accidents, motorcycle accidents, and slip and falls to more complex areas such as medical malpractice, product liability, and wrongful death. He is also well-versed in commercial and real property litigation, as well as premises liability and negligent security cases. This wide-reaching expertise ensures that he can provide strategic and effective advocacy for clients facing many different types of legal challenges.

Today, Leo is a vital member of the Morgan & Morgan office in Phoenix, where he serves a diverse community with his unique linguistic abilities. He is fluent in English, Mandarin, and Korean, allowing him to communicate directly and comfortably with a wide array of clients. Beyond his work in the office, he is an active participant in the legal community as a member of the Arizona Asian American Bar Association.
